What’s New in Chrome 146: Features Developers and Site Owners Shouldn’t Ignore
Chrome 146 introduces several platform improvements that directly impact how modern websites are built, secured, and optimized. From richer scroll-triggered animations to safer DOM manipulation with the Sanitizer API, these updates matter for both developers and business owners focused on performance, security, and user experience. This overview distills the most important changes and how they affect your WordPress or custom web projects.
Key Takeaways
- Scroll-triggered animations make it easier to create smooth, performant effects tied to user scrolling without heavy JavaScript.
- Scoped custom element registries improve component isolation, making complex interfaces and design systems easier to manage.
- The Sanitizer API offers a safer, built-in way to clean user-generated content and reduce XSS risks.
- These features can improve performance, security, and SEO when implemented correctly in WordPress and custom web applications.
Scroll-Triggered Animations: Smoother UX With Less JavaScript
Scroll-triggered animations have become standard in modern websites, from subtle fade-ins to complex parallax effects. Historically, these effects relied on JavaScript scroll listeners or third-party libraries, which can hurt performance and introduce layout jank. Chrome 146 strengthens native support for scroll-linked animations, giving developers a more efficient way to control motion.
How Scroll-Triggered Animations Work
With the latest capabilities, animations can be tied directly to the scroll offset using CSS and the Web Animations API, rather than constant JavaScript updates. This enables the browser to optimize the animation pipeline for smoother transitions and better battery life on mobile devices.
For example, instead of using a scroll event listener to toggle classes or compute animation values on every frame, you can define animation timelines linked to scroll progress. The browser then handles the synchronization internally, often on a separate thread, reducing main-thread workload.
Business impact: Native scroll-triggered animations can cut down on heavy animation libraries, reducing page weight and improving Core Web Vitals—key signals for SEO and user engagement.
Practical Uses in WordPress and Custom Sites
For WordPress sites, especially those using page builders or animation-heavy themes, moving to native scroll-triggered animations can:
- Decrease dependency on large JavaScript animation libraries.
- Improve scroll performance on content-heavy pages.
- Deliver more consistent animations across devices.
Custom web applications and SPAs can also benefit by using these APIs for dashboards, storytelling experiences, and product landing pages where movement reflects user progress rather than timed animations.
Scoped Custom Element Registries: Cleaner, Safer Component Architectures
Modern interfaces often rely on Web Components for reusable UI elements. A long-standing challenge has been that custom element definitions live in a global registry, making it difficult to isolate components from different sources or versions. Chrome 146 adds support for scoped custom element registries, a significant step forward for modular front-end architectures.
What Are Scoped Custom Element Registries?
A scoped custom element registry allows you to define custom elements that are only available within a specific shadow root or subtree, rather than the entire document. This avoids naming collisions and enables multiple versions of the same component to coexist without conflicts.
For instance, you can have two different components both named <app-button> used in different parts of the page, each with their own implementation and style, without interfering with one another.
Why This Matters for Large Sites and WordPress Builders
Scoped registries are particularly relevant in complex systems such as:
- WordPress sites with multiple plugins and themes defining their own custom elements.
- Design systems used across multiple micro-frontends or embedded widgets.
- Sites gradually migrating from legacy components to new implementations.
By scoping registries, developers can:
- Avoid hard-to-debug conflicts between components from different vendors.
- Ship incremental updates to UI libraries without breaking existing pages.
- Bundle self-contained widgets that can be safely embedded into any site.
Technical advantage: Scoped custom element registries enable more reliable component reuse, making it easier to scale large, modular front-ends without fragile global dependencies.
Sanitizer API: Built-In Defense Against Malicious Content
Security remains a critical concern for any web property that accepts or displays user-generated content—comments, reviews, support tickets, or form submissions. Chrome 146 strengthens support for the Sanitizer API, giving developers a browser-native way to safely inject HTML into the DOM.
The Problem With Manual Sanitization
Traditionally, developers sanitize content on the server or use client-side libraries to strip dangerous tags and attributes before injecting HTML. This approach is error-prone and easy to misconfigure, potentially leaving gaps for cross-site scripting (XSS) attacks.
In environments like WordPress, where multiple plugins and themes can touch the same content, inconsistencies in sanitization logic are common—and dangerous.
How the Sanitizer API Helps
The Sanitizer API provides:
- A browser-maintained list of allowed elements and attributes.
- Configurable policies to tailor what HTML is permitted.
- Safe methods for converting untrusted input into DOM nodes.
Instead of manually parsing strings and assigning them to innerHTML, developers can use the API to create sanitized fragments the browser guarantees are free from certain classes of injection attacks.
Security benefit: Using the Sanitizer API reduces reliance on custom sanitization logic and third-party libraries, tightening your overall security posture and reducing XSS risk.
Implications for WordPress Security
For WordPress developers and agencies, the Sanitizer API offers a new layer of defense when:
- Building custom Gutenberg blocks that render user-configurable HTML.
- Creating front-end forms that display user content without full page reloads.
- Integrating third-party data sources or embedding rich content in dashboards.
While server-side validation and sanitization remain mandatory, leveraging this browser-level API adds important redundancy, particularly in dynamic interfaces where client-side manipulations are frequent.
Additional Platform Improvements in Chrome 146
Beyond the headline features, Chrome 146 includes enhancements that further refine the web platform for performance, maintainability, and SEO. While some of these are incremental, together they support more robust and efficient sites.
Improved Performance and Responsiveness
Changes to how the browser schedules animation and rendering tasks can smooth out interactions on complex pages. When combined with scroll-triggered animations and better use of the Web Animations API, this can contribute to:
- Lower input latency on interactive pages.
- Improved animation smoothness, especially on low-power devices.
- More predictable layout behavior under heavy load.
For businesses, these performance improvements can translate into higher conversion rates and better user satisfaction, both of which can positively influence SEO metrics such as engagement and dwell time.
Developer Experience Enhancements
Chrome 146 also iterates on DevTools and debugging capabilities, making it easier to inspect animations, diagnose layout shifts, and analyze security issues. While these tools do not directly change site behavior, they enable developers to identify and fix problems faster, reducing time-to-resolution for performance or security regressions.
What This Means for Business Owners and Technical Teams
The updates in Chrome 146 are not just theoretical improvements; they offer tangible advantages for organizations running WordPress sites or custom web platforms. Leveraging these capabilities can strengthen your competitive edge in speed, security, and user experience.
For Business Owners
From a non-technical perspective, the key outcomes of adopting these features are:
- Better user experience: Smoother animations and interactions without sacrificing load times.
- Stronger security posture: Fewer avenues for malicious scripts to exploit user-generated content.
- Improved SEO potential: Performance and stability improvements support better search rankings.
When discussing roadmap priorities with your development team or agency, it is worth asking how and when they plan to leverage these platform-level enhancements in your projects.
For Developers and Technical Leads
Development teams should consider:
- Refactoring heavy JavaScript-based scroll effects to use native scroll-triggered animations where possible.
- Adopting scoped custom element registries in design systems and component libraries to reduce global coupling.
- Integrating the Sanitizer API into client-side rendering flows that handle untrusted input.
These steps can align your codebase with modern best practices in performance optimization, cybersecurity, and maintainable architecture.
Conclusion
Chrome 146 strengthens the web platform in three crucial areas: visual richness through scroll-triggered animations, architectural robustness via scoped custom element registries, and improved security with the Sanitizer API. Together, these changes support building sites that are faster, safer, and easier to maintain.
For both WordPress implementations and fully custom solutions, now is a good time to review your front-end strategy and identify where legacy approaches—heavy animation libraries, global custom element registries, or ad hoc sanitization—can be replaced with these newer, built-in capabilities.
Need Professional Help?
Our team specializes in delivering enterprise-grade solutions for businesses of all sizes.
Explore Our Services →Share this article:
Need Help With Your Website?
Whether you need web design, hosting, SEO, or digital marketing services, we're here to help your St. Louis business succeed online.
Get a Free Quote